Carrot Cake Recipe You’ll Crave – Moist, Easy & Homemade

If you’ve ever wondered how to make carrot cake so moist it melts on your tongue, you’re in for something special. This article shares a carrot cake recipe packed with flavor—thanks to carrots, pineapple, and a luscious cream cheese frosting. Whether you’re baking your first cake or hunting for a new homemade carrot cake favorite, this guide walks you through each step, with tips, tools, and secrets from my Appalachian kitchen. You’ll also find out why carrot cake with cream cheese frosting is more than just a dessert—it’s a memory in every slice.

serving carrot cake recipe

Moist Carrot Cake with Pineapple & Cream Cheese Frosting

de43a779b643bc60de94feaefff3fb7fLilia Karin
This moist carrot cake is packed with freshly grated carrots, crushed pineapple, and warm spices, then topped with a rich cream cheese frosting. It’s a nostalgic, comforting dessert perfect for celebrations or cozy weekends.
Prep Time 20 minutes
Cook Time 40 minutes
Total Time 1 hour
Course Dessert
Cuisine American
Servings 12 servings
Calories 410 kcal

Equipment

  • Mixing bowls
  • Whisk or electric mixer
  • Box grater or food processor
  • Rubber spatula
  • 9×13 baking pan or two 8-inch pans
  • Cooling rack

Ingredients
  

  • 2 cups all-purpose flour
  • 1 ½ teaspoons baking powder
  • 1 teaspoon baking soda
  • ½ teaspoon salt
  • 1 ½ teaspoons ground cinnamon
  • ½ teaspoon nutmeg
  • ¾ cup vegetable oil
  • 4 large eggs
  • 1 ½ cups granulated sugar
  • 2 teaspoons vanilla extract
  • 2 cups freshly grated carrots
  • 1 cup crushed pineapple, well-drained
  • ½ cup chopped walnuts or pecans (optional)
  • 8 oz cream cheese (block-style, not spreadable)
  • ½ cup unsalted butter, softened
  • 2 cups powdered sugar
  • 1 teaspoon vanilla extract

Instructions
 

  • Preheat oven to 350°F (175°C). Grease a 9×13 inch baking pan or two 8-inch round pans.
  • In a large bowl, whisk together flour, baking powder, baking soda, salt, cinnamon, and nutmeg.
  • In another bowl, mix oil, sugar, eggs, and vanilla until smooth.
  • Fold the dry ingredients into the wet mixture until just combined.
  • Add grated carrots, crushed pineapple, and nuts (if using). Stir until evenly mixed.
  • Pour the batter into prepared pan(s) and bake for 35–40 minutes, or until a toothpick comes out clean.
  • Let the cake cool completely in the pan.
  • For the frosting: beat cream cheese and butter until smooth. Add powdered sugar and vanilla, and mix until fluffy.
  • Frost the cooled cake. Slice, serve, and enjoy.

Notes

You can substitute half the oil with applesauce for a lighter version.
Double the frosting for a layered cake.
Store leftovers in the fridge for up to 5 days.
Can be made a day in advance—flavor improves overnight.

Nutrition

Calories: 410kcalCarbohydrates: 48gProtein: 5gFat: 22gSaturated Fat: 8gPolyunsaturated Fat: 2.5gMonounsaturated Fat: 9.5gCholesterol: 65mgSodium: 290mgPotassium: 180mgFiber: 2gSugar: 35gVitamin A: 6500IUVitamin C: 2mgCalcium: 60mgIron: 1.3mg
Keyword carrot cake and pineapple, carrot cake with cream cheese frosting, easy carrot cake recipe, homemade carrot cake, moist carrot cake recipe, vegan carrot cake recipe
Tried this recipe?Let us know how it was!
Table Of Contents

The Story & Intro — Why This Carrot Cake Recipe Means Everything to Me

The Carrot Cake Recipe That Started It All

My journey with carrot cake started long before I ever wrote down a proper carrot cake recipe. I was twelve, barefoot in my grandma’s kitchen, baking a lopsided cake in a toaster oven. It wasn’t perfect, but it was homemade—and it tasted like hope. That’s the magic of a good homemade carrot cake: even when it’s messy, it means something.

Years later, in my own kitchen outside Asheville, I found myself chasing that same warmth. I tested every carrot cake recipe I could find, adjusting spices, textures, and mix-ins. What finally worked was a blend of grated carrots, crushed pineapple, and just enough cinnamon to feel like a hug. This isn’t just any cake—it’s a homemade carrot cake that’s moist, rich, and full of soul.

The secret? Balance. The carrots bring earthiness, the pineapple adds moisture, and the frosting? Oh, that carrot cake with cream cheese frosting is the crown jewel. It’s tangy, silky, and thick enough to swirl with the back of a spoon. No piping bags required—just real flavor.

I bake this carrot cake recipe for birthdays, holidays, and honestly, whenever life needs a sweet pause. It’s the kind of dessert that gets whispered about across the table and wrapped up for someone to take home. If you’ve ever wondered how to make carrot cake that feels both classic and unforgettable, this is it.

And yes, I’ll say it: carrot cake and pineapple belong together. Once you taste it, you’ll understand why. If you’re looking for a plant-based spin on this classic, my vegan carrot cake recipe offers all the flavor and moisture, minus the dairy.

Just like my first attempt at baking, which was more hopeful than perfect, the charm of rustic bakes like this carrot cake or the beloved Lady Linda coffee cake lies in their honest simplicity.

Moist and Flavorful – What Makes the Best Carrot Cake Recipe

How to Make Carrot Cake That’s Never Dry

Let’s be honest—there’s nothing worse than a dry carrot cake. If you’ve ever followed a carrot cake recipe only to end up with something bland or crumbly, I feel your pain. That’s why moisture is at the heart of any good homemade carrot cake. And the trick isn’t just the carrots—it’s what you pair them with.

carrot cake recipe ingredients
All the ingredients you need for homemade carrot cake

The ingredient that changed everything for me? Pineapple. Yep, adding crushed pineapple gives the cake a subtle tang and a soft, juicy texture you won’t get from carrots alone. That perfect balance is what makes this carrot cake and pineapple combo such a favorite in my kitchen. The result is a cake that stays tender for days—if it lasts that long. If you love pineapple in your bakes, you’ll definitely want to check out my pineapple upside-down cake, which plays with similar fruit-forward textures.

You’ll also want to shred your carrots fresh. Pre-shredded bags are convenient, sure, but they’re too dry for baking. Grab a box grater or food processor and go for fine shreds—they melt into the batter and add natural sweetness.

I also use buttermilk or sour cream to round out the batter. These tangy ingredients deepen the flavor and make each bite richer. If you’re curious how to make carrot cake that tastes like it came from a cozy mountain bakery, this is the foundation.

The Right Spices Make All the Difference

You don’t need an entire spice cabinet—just cinnamon, a pinch of nutmeg, and a whisper of ginger. These warm notes highlight the carrots and pineapple without overpowering them. The result? A carrot cake recipe that tastes layered and comforting, never flat.

For a similarly moist and nostalgic slice, try my Mary Berry coconut cake, another reader-favorite that uses simple ingredients and big flavor.

Cream Cheese Frosting – The Icing That Makes It Iconic

Why Carrot Cake with Cream Cheese Frosting Is Non-Negotiable

Let’s get one thing straight: a carrot cake recipe isn’t complete without cream cheese frosting. You can skip the walnuts, tweak the spice blend, or even make it in cupcake form—but the frosting? That’s the soul of the cake.

Carrot cake with cream cheese frosting is the pairing that makes people close their eyes after the first bite. It’s the contrast that works so well: a rich, warmly spiced cake topped with something cool, tangy, and a little sweet. It’s not just frosting—it’s balance.

Making it from scratch is easier than you think. All you need is full-fat cream cheese (cold from the fridge), softened butter, powdered sugar, and a splash of real vanilla extract. Beat it until smooth and fluffy. Want a little edge? Add a touch of lemon zest or a pinch of salt—it brightens everything up.

Don’t worry about being fancy. No need to pipe rosettes or get a glossy finish. Just take an offset spatula (or the back of a spoon like I do) and swoop generous dollops across the top. Homemade carrot cake doesn’t need to look perfect—it needs to taste perfect. If you’re a fan of bright, tangy flavors like cream cheese frosting, you might also love the citrus zing in my key lime cake recipe.

Frosting Tips You’ll Be Glad You Knew

To avoid a runny mess, always use block-style cream cheese, not the spreadable kind. And chill the cake completely before frosting—otherwise, you’ll end up with a slip-and-slide situation.

I usually frost this cake as a single layer in a 9×13 pan. It’s simple, easy to serve, and just as beautiful. If you’re making a double-layer round cake, double the frosting—it’s too good not to.

For a cake that always gets compliments, this frosting is the finishing touch. The smooth cream cheese swirl also pairs beautifully with fruit-based cakes like this strawberry pound cake that I bake every spring.

Easy Steps to Make the Best Homemade Carrot Cake Recipe

Your Go-To Guide for How to Make Carrot Cake at Home

Now that we’ve talked ingredients and frosting, let’s walk through how to make carrot cake the easy way. This carrot cake recipe is a one-bowl wonder that doesn’t ask for anything fancy. Just simple steps, pantry basics, and a few tips that make all the difference.

how to make carrot cake recipe
Pouring carrot cake batter into a pan

Start by whisking your dry ingredients: all-purpose flour, baking soda, salt, and warm spices. In a separate bowl, mix sugar, oil, eggs, and vanilla until smooth. Then gently fold the dry mix into the wet. From here, stir in the heart of this homemade carrot cake—freshly grated carrots, crushed pineapple, and chopped pecans if you like a little crunch.

The pineapple isn’t optional if you’re after moisture. It’s what transforms a good carrot cake recipe into a truly unforgettable one. And when people ask why this carrot cake and pineapple combo works so well? Tell them: it’s the texture, the tang, and the way it keeps the cake soft for days.

Once your batter is ready, pour it into a greased pan—9×13 if you want a fuss-free classic, or two round pans for a layer cake. Bake at 350°F until a toothpick comes out clean, about 35–40 minutes.

Whether you prefer carrot cake or a yellow cake with chocolate buttercream, both offer timeless, crowd-pleasing flavor.

Cool, Frost, and Savor Every Bite

Let the cake cool fully before spreading that rich cream cheese frosting we talked about earlier. Don’t rush this step—warm cake will melt your frosting and ruin that smooth finish.

serving carrot cake recipe
Slice of homemade carrot cake with frosting

This carrot cake recipe is perfect for birthdays, brunches, or just a Sunday craving. It also freezes beautifully, so go ahead and make an extra batch.

And if you’re watching ingredients or need a flour-free option, my vegan flourless chocolate cake is rich, indulgent, and shockingly simple.

Frequently Asked Questions About Carrot Cake Recipe

How to make carrot cake recipe at home?

To make a carrot cake recipe at home, start by mixing oil, eggs, sugar, and vanilla. Combine with flour, baking soda, cinnamon, and salt. Fold in shredded carrots, crushed pineapple, and optional nuts. Pour into a greased pan and bake at 350°F for 35–40 minutes. Once cool, frost with cream cheese icing. This homemade carrot cake is rich, moist, and crowd-pleasing.

What is the best carrot cake recipe?

The best carrot cake recipe includes fresh carrots, crushed pineapple, and a perfect balance of spices. Moisture is key—pineapple helps achieve that soft texture, while the tangy cream cheese frosting complements the sweet cake beautifully. Whether you bake it in layers or a simple pan, this recipe delivers consistent, delicious results every time.

Do you have a recipe for carrot cake with pineapple?

Yes! This carrot cake recipe features crushed pineapple for added moisture and natural sweetness. The pineapple blends perfectly with the carrots and spices, giving the cake that soft, tender bite every good homemade carrot cake should have. It’s an essential part of what makes this cake so unforgettable.

Can I make carrot cake without frosting?

You can skip the frosting if you’d like, but honestly, carrot cake with cream cheese frosting is what brings everything together. If you want a lighter version, a dusting of powdered sugar or a dollop of whipped cream can work too. But nothing beats that tangy-sweet finish from cream cheese.

Conclusion

There’s something timeless about a great carrot cake recipe. It’s rustic yet elegant, homey yet special. With simple ingredients like carrots, pineapple, and a touch of spice, this homemade carrot cake becomes more than dessert—it becomes a memory.

Whether you’re learning how to make carrot cake for the first time or returning to a beloved classic, this guide gives you everything you need. From choosing the right ingredients to mastering that dreamy cream cheese frosting, you’re now ready to bake a cake that tastes like home.

And remember—cake isn’t just food. It’s comfort. It’s celebration. It’s love on a plate.

for more cake recipes follow us in facebook page

Leave a Comment

Recipe Rating